Indiana Music Educators Association Inc is located in Indianapolis, IN. The organization was established in 1975. According to its NTEE Classification (B03) the organization is classified as: Professional Societies & Associations, under the broad grouping of Education and related organizations. This organization is an independent organization and not affiliated with a larger national or regional group of organizations. Indiana Music Educators Association Inc is a 501(c)(6) and as such, is described as a "Business League, Chambers of Commerce, or Real Estate Board" by the IRS.
For the year ending 06/2021, Indiana Music Educators Association Inc generated $274.7k in total revenue. This represents a relatively dramatic decline in revenue. Over the past 6 years, the organization has seen revenues fall by an average of (8.1%) each year. All expenses for the organization totaled $269.5k during the year ending 06/2021. As we would expect to see with falling revenues, expenses have declined by (8.2%) per year over the past 6 years. Describe the Organization's Mission:
Part 3 - Line 1
PROMOTE MUSIC EDUCATION- THE ORGANIZATION'S MISSION IS TO PROMOTE MUSIC EDUCATION IN INDIANA BY PROVIDING TRAINING, CONTINUING EDUCATION MATERIALS AND SEMINARS.
Describe the Organization's Program Activity:
Part 3 - Line 4a
INDIANA MUSIC EDUCATORS CONFERENCE/CONVENTION - THE ASSOCIATION SPONSORS A THREE DAY EVENT ANNUALLY TO SUPPORT AND ADVANCE MUSIC EDCATION IN THE STATE OF INDIANA.
CIRCLE THE STATE WITH SONG - STATEWIDE FESTIVALS PROVIDING STUDENTS IN GRADES 4 THROUGH 9 WITH THE OPPORTUNITY TO EXPERIENCE QUALITY PERFORMANCES WITH OTHER STUDENTS FROM THEIR AREA AND TO PROVIDE MUSIC HONOR STUDENTS, WHO ARE READY MORE CHALLENGING MUSIC AND WORK WITH GUEST CHORAL CLINICIANS.
HONOR CHOIR, HONOR BAND - SPONSORS STATEWIDE ELEMENTARY SCHOOL AND MIDDLE SCHOOL CHOIRS AND BANDS.
